White Mound
Discover a family-friendly campground where comfort meets outdoor adventure at White Mound. Perfect for making memories amidst nature, with amenities that cater to all ages.
White Mound operates a public park and campground that offers shelter rentals, multiple campsites, and dedicated horse camping. The property features two unique shelters, each with electricity and ADA accessibility, and permits for ten vehicles per shelter. White Mound lists more than fifty individual campsites by site number, including seasonal and electric sites, and a varied selection of horse campsites designed for equestrian use.
Amenities across campsites include electric and water hookups, restrooms, picnic tables, fire rings, coin-operated showers, laundry facilities, a playground, and a basketball hoop. Several sites provide ADA accessible options. Horse campsites include dedicated facilities for horses and riders, with access to scenic trails, corrals, and practical hookup points for tack and water.
Many numbered campsites include fire rings and picnic tables for outdoor cooking and dining. Coin-operated showers and laundry facilities support extended stays, and playgrounds plus basketball hoop offer family recreation. Site listings identify which numbered sites include electric or water hookups to aid trip planning.
Reservations can be made for shelter rental and individual campsites; site descriptions specify services and accessibility. The park supports day-use gatherings, family camping, and equestrian camping, making it suitable for a broad range of outdoor activities.
